Collesalvetti - San Giuliano Terme - Cascina


A road cycling route starting from Collesalvetti

Exploring the countryside from Collesalvetti to Cascina

Map

This 69 km road route takes you on a scenic journey through the picturesque countryside between Collesalvetti and Cascina. Along the way, you will pass through the charming towns of Coltano, San Giuliano Terme, and Spuntone, and take in the stunning views of vineyards and olive groves. End your ride in Cascina, known for its beautiful historic center and delicious traditional cuisine.

Collesalvetti: Exploring Toscana's hills in Collesalvetti
Collesalvetti is a town located in the Toscana region of Italy. As a road and gravel cyclist, you will find some interesting routes and enjoyable rides in the area. Collesalvetti is surrounded by hills, offering gentle climbs and scenic countryside views. One notable cycling spot nearby is the Monte Serra climb, a challenging ascent that attracts cyclists from near and far. With its pleasant roads and beautiful landscapes, Collesalvetti is a decent choice for cyclists looking for a mix of moderate challenges and enjoyable rides.
